Top Notes

Top notes are the initial scents you smell when you first apply a fragrance. They are typically light and evaporate quickly, lasting about 5 to 15 minutes. Top notes create the first impression and are crucial in shaping the overall perception of the fragrance.

Examples:

- Citrus: Lemon, Bergamot, Orange

- Herbs: Basil, Mint, Coriander

- Fruits: Apple, Pineapple, Blackberry

Middle Notes (Heart Notes)

Middle notes emerge once the top notes evaporate and can last from 20 minutes to an hour or more. They form the core of the fragrance and help mask the initial sharpness of the top notes while blending smoothly with the base notes.

Examples:

- Floral: Rose, Jasmine, Lavender

- Spices: Cinnamon, Cardamom, Nutmeg

- Green: Grass, Tea, Ivy

Base Notes

Base notes are the foundation of the fragrance and become more noticeable after the middle notes dissipate. They add depth and richness, anchoring the lighter notes. Base notes are long-lasting and can remain on the skin for several hours, sometimes even days.

Examples:

- Woody: Sandalwood, Cedarwood, Vetiver

- Resins: Amber, Myrrh, Frankincense

- Animalic: Musk, Civet, Leather

Example of a Fragrance Breakdown

Let's take an example of a popular fragrance to illustrate the notes:

Fragrance: Chanel No. 5

- Top Notes: Aldehydes, Neroli, Ylang-Ylang, Bergamot, Lemon

- Middle Notes: Iris, Jasmine, Rose, Orris Root, Lily-of-the-Valley

- Base Notes: Vetiver, Musk, Sandalwood, Patchouli, Oakmoss, Amber, Vanilla
